Pakistan - Export of Self-Tapping Screws of Iron or Steel
Since 2013, Pakistan Export of Self-Tapping Screws of Iron or Steel decreased by 47.5% year on year. In 2018, the country was ranked number 94 comparing other countries in Export of Self-Tapping Screws of Iron or Steel at $2,215.13. Pakistan is overtaken by Fiji, which was ranked number 93 with $2,812.95 and is followed by Senegal with $2,016.86. Germany topped the ranking with $662,186,841.4 in 2019, +0.1% versus 2018. China, Czech Republic and Switzerland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Paraguay recorded the best 5 years average growth at +428.7% per year, while Antigua and Barbuda recorded the worst performance at -71.3% per year.
